Backup Battery

The backup battery provides the system with auxiliary power in the event of a power failure at your home. Depending on the age of the battery, it can provide up to 12 hours of power. Should the battery reach a level the system terms as vulnerable to system failure, the system will send a low battery signal to our central station monitoring center so that we may alert you of a pending system failure.

Low Battery Alarm: A low battery alarm means that the system has been running off battery power for long enough for the battery to be drained and could possibly fail if the power is off to the system much longer. When the system power comes back on your battery should recharge. If you are in an area that has frequent power failures your battery will get worn out faster than the average battery. We recommend they be replaced every 5 years.
